Ir para conteúdo
Fórum Script Brasil
  • 0

Formulário "telefone" Com Números Fixos


Guest --Paulo --

Pergunta

Guest --Paulo --

Olá pessoal,

Gostaria de colocar aquela opção no meu formulário, campo telefone que limita a quantidade de números digitados e obriga a pessoa a digitar o código DDD, tipo: "Telefone (55)3232-3232

Valeu.

Link para o comentário
Compartilhar em outros sites

4 respostass a esta questão

Posts Recomendados

  • 0
Guest JOCEILTON GOMES

Quer saber como se cria um formulario com mascara assim abaixo:

DATA : 22/00/0000

CPF : 000.000.000-00

TEL : (098) 0000-0000

CONTA: 00000000-0

Entre outros o script está abaixo

Certo:

<html>

<head><cript language="JavaScript">
    function formatar(src, mask) {
        var i = src.value.length;
        var saida = mask.substring(i,i+1);
        var ascii = event.keyCode;
        if (saida == "A") {
            if ((ascii >=97) && (ascii <= 122)) { event.keyCode -= 32; }
            else { event.keyCode = 0; }
        } else if (saida == "0") {
            if ((ascii >= 48) && (ascii <= 57)) { return }
            else { event.keyCode = 0 }
        } else if (saida == "#") {
            return;
        } else {
            src.value += saida;
            i += 1
            saida = mask.substring(i,i+1);
            if (saida == "A") {
                if ((ascii >=97) && (ascii <= 122)) { event.keyCode -= 32; }
                else { event.keyCode = 0; }
            } else if (saida == "0") {
                if ((ascii >= 48) && (ascii <= 57)) { return }
                else { event.keyCode = 0 }
            } else { return; }
        }
    }
</script>
<meta http-equiv="Content-Type" content="text/html; charset=windows-1252">
<title>Nova pagina 1</title>
</head>
CPF&nbsp;
<input onKeyPress="formatar(this,'000.000.000-00')" name="Cnpj" size="18" maxlength="14" style="border-style:dashed; border-width:1px; font-family: Verdana; font-size: 8pt; font-weight:700; padding-left:4px; padding-right:4px; padding-top:1px; padding-bottom:1px; background-color:#FFFFFF">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p; </font>
            <font color="#000000">
<body>

</font>
<p>DATA
<input onKeyPress="formatar(this,'00/00/0000')" name="Cnpj0" size="15" maxlength="10" style="border-style:dashed; border-width:1px; font-family: Verdana; font-size: 8pt; font-weight:700; padding-left:4px; padding-right:4px; padding-top:1px; padding-bottom:1px; background-color:#FFFFFF"></p>

</body>

</html>

Copie e cole no seu PC é muito bom

Inicio de um formulario:

Informamos que os dados a serem mudados ("formatar(this,'000.000.000-00')" em que está em negrito código abaixo do formulário

Maiores informações: joceilton@credbank.com.br

Editado por andreia_sp
Utilize caixa baixa e tags para códigos
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,2k
    • Posts
      651,9k
×
×
  • Criar Novo...